<p>There was also another reason why I went into the Best Buy hellhole yesterday: to look at digital SLRs. I&#8217;ve been looking for a camera since my parents have all but adopted my old Olympus point-and-shoot. I&#8217;ve really wanted a DSLR that shoots video, so I won&#8217;t have to decide on whether to buy a video or still camera, so I looked first at the Canon Digital Rebel T1i. I really liked the controls on this camera. I was changing modes and tweaking f-stops in short time, and this is coming from a guy whose only SLR experience was with a Pentax K1000. I played with the T1i for a bit, and then a gave a Nikon a chance. I can&#8217;t remember what model it was, since I couldn&#8217;t decipher the confusing buttons and interface. It could have been the D90, but I dunno. Then I went back to a Canon, in particular the EOS 5D. It had the same easy-to-use controls, but the kit lens and continuous shooting was kickass. I have never played with continuous shooting before, so I was almost giggling with delight at the prospect of shooting several pictures a second with relative ease.</p>
<p>I&#8217;ve also looked on the web for that perfect camera, and I&#8217;ve found another candidate: the Pentax K-x. In the same body as the K2000, another former candidate, it adds a better sensor and 720p HD video. It&#8217;s also cheaper than the Canon T1i. It may end up my final decision, once money becomes available.</p>

<p>Other than Black Friday, my Thanksgiving break has been fun. Dinners at relatives&#8217; houses, sitting around in a turkey coma, and yet another dinner on Saturday at a good friend&#8217;s. My friend who is also an uncle to several nieces and nephews, who we escorted to the playground at the elementary school after their constant demands. We went to the playground I once played on in elementary school. It had been what seems like forever since I had been on the grounds of Valley View Elementary. The majority of the playground equipment I played on was no longer there, being moved either to the less used playground on the other side of campus or banished to the pathetic city park on the edge of town. It was all plastic and sterile now; nothing like the bumpy metal slide that burned your ass in the summer and countless kids fell off of, or the gargantuan (when I was little) spiral slide that also burned your ass in the summer and suffered from traffic jams when a kid would decide to block the way. There would sometimes be at least twenty of us crammed onto that slide at one time. How all of it had changed made me feel old. But it was still cool to see kids enjoy the same little schoolyard I enjoyed. It may not be the best school in the world, but you sure can&#8217;t say it&#8217;s not a memorable one.</p>
